PT7C43390LE Specifications

  • Type
    Parameter
  • Supplier Device Package
    8-MSOP
  • Package / Case
    8-TSSOP, 8-MSOP (0.118", 3.00mm Width)
  • Mounting Type
    Surface Mount
  • Operating Temperature
    -40°C ~ 85°C
  • Interface
    I²C, 2-Wire Serial
  • Date Format
    YY-MM-DD-dd
  • Time Format
    HH:MM:SS (12/24 hr)
  • Type
    Clock/Calendar
  • DigiKey Programmable
    Not Verified
  • Product Status
    Obsolete
  • Packaging
    Tube

The PT7C43390LE is a specific model of integrated circuit chip manufactured by Pericom Semiconductor. It is a real-time clock (RTC) chip with several advantages and application scenarios. Here are some of them:Advantages: 1. Low power consumption: The PT7C43390LE is designed to operate with minimal power requirements, making it suitable for battery-powered devices or applications where power efficiency is crucial. 2. Accurate timekeeping: It provides precise timekeeping capabilities with a typical accuracy of ±2 minutes per month. 3. Small form factor: The chip comes in a compact package, making it suitable for space-constrained designs. 4. Wide operating voltage range: It can operate within a wide voltage range, typically from 1.3V to 5.5V, allowing compatibility with various power supply configurations. 5. I2C interface: The chip utilizes the I2C (Inter-Integrated Circuit) communication protocol, which is widely supported by microcontrollers and other devices, enabling easy integration into existing systems.Application scenarios: 1.
